A new leak reveals how Samsung’s upcoming Galaxy Z Flip 7 FE will differ from the standard Flip 7. The most obvious change is the outer display design, with the FE version using an older, more affordable approach.
Major Outer Display Difference
The biggest change between the two models is the cover display. The standard Galaxy Z Flip 7 copies the Motorola Razr series by extending its outer screen to all four sides and wrapping around the cameras.
The Galaxy Z Flip 7 FE keeps the folder-style cover display that first appeared on the Galaxy Z Flip 5. This design choice is clearly a cost-cutting measure, similar to what Motorola does with its base Razr model.

Different Color Options
The leak shows different color choices for each model:
- Galaxy Z Flip 7: Blue, red, and black
- Galaxy Z Flip 7 FE: Black and white only
Samsung may announce additional color variants that weren’t shown in this leak.

Launch Timeline
Samsung has announced a July 9 event to launch the Galaxy Z Fold 7 and Flip 7. The Galaxy Z Flip 7 FE may also be available after that date, despite previous rumors suggesting a delay.
